The car did not crash because of the cyclists. This looks to be somewhere in Great Britain, so the cyclists are on the correct side of the road (and also, completely fine to cycle there). The passing van is already back on the correct side as they pass the camera. The crashing car drove too fast for the turn and weather conditions and skidded out. Notice the “slow” written on the road, indicating the driving side and the turning road.

They would’ve crashed regardless of the cyclists being there or not.
